Nollywood actress and filmmaker Toyin Abraham has dismissed reports alleging that her marriage to fellow actor Kolawole Ajeyemi is facing a crisis.
The speculation surfaced on social media after blogger Bukky Jesse reportedly claimed that the couple were no longer on good terms and that Toyin had moved into her newly built house. The claim quickly generated reactions among fans and followers of the actors.
Toyin, however, reacted to the report in the comment section, appearing to reject the allegation and praying against anything that could cause separation between her and her husband.
“Ako loruko baba, Omo ati emi mimo. Ori wa ko, eleda wa ko,” the actress wrote in response.
The statement, which was accompanied by prayer emojis, was interpreted as Toyin’s way of addressing the reports without directly engaging in a lengthy explanation of her private life.
The development is significant because Toyin Abraham and Kolawole Ajeyemi are among the well-known couples in Nigeria’s entertainment industry, and reports about their relationship frequently attract public attention. The latest allegation also highlights how social media reports about celebrities’ private lives can quickly gain traction before being independently verified.
The couple have previously spoken publicly about their relationship. In July 2026, Toyin described Kolawole as “the best thing that has ever happened” to her while discussing how he has supported her personal choices and career.
Kolawole has also previously spoken positively about their marriage, saying that love, mutual support and tolerance are important to a successful relationship.
Toyin Abraham and Kolawole Ajeyemi got married in 2019 after building a relationship within the Yoruba film industry. They welcomed their first child, Iremide, the same year.
